GL1100DC questions, answered with data

What are the most common problems with the Honda GL1100DC?

Across 92 UK examples, the most frequently recorded MOT faults are brakes (14.8% of all recorded faults), lights and indicators (14.8% of all recorded faults), controls and cables (11.1% of all recorded faults).

What is average mileage for a Honda GL1100DC?

The median Honda GL1100DC in the UK has covered 44,453 miles, and typically rides about 545 miles a year. Half of all examples fall between 37,882 and 53,379 miles.

Is the Honda GL1100DC reliable?

79.49% of Honda GL1100DC MOT tests are passed first time, with an average of 0.59 faults recorded per test. This is measured from DVSA MOT records, not owner opinion.
